In 2021, Windcrest, TX had a population of 5.83k people with a median age of 49.1 and a median household income of $83,667.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Windcrest, TX declined from 5,854 to 5,830, a −0.41% decrease and its median household income grew from $80,069 to $83,667, a 4.49%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Windcrest, TX are White (Non-Hispanic) (52.6%), White (Hispanic) (19.1%), Two+ (Hispanic) (10.1%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(6.91%), and Asian (Non-Hispanic) (5.78%).
None of the households in Windcrest, TX re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
96.4% of the residents in Windcrest, TX are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Windcrest, TX was $225,400, and the homeownership rate was 86.6%.
Most people in Windcrest, TX dr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 23.7 minutes. The average car ownership in Windcrest, TX was 2 cars per household.
